Ahead of today’s match against Northampton Town, we asked our members what three things they think The Imps need to do to pick up all three points.

Here’s what elkimp said:

1. With a high wind forecast, this could be a game to play a bit more on the deck, like the Andrade goal last week. We proved again we can play through the thirds. Do this and get the ball to the feet of Andrade, Anderson, Rowe and Akinde and we will cause problems. Shackell and even Bostwick can set the tempo with this. But the key is movement and willingness from the midfield to come looking for the ball.

2. Get Danny Rowe back in the number 10 spot. He looked great there for two games, scoring three goals and linking up with Akinde nicely. Probably the first player this season to really look comfortable there. McCartan looks only an impact player now, Pett better further back and Rheady for last 10/15 when required.

3. The FULL and unconditional support of the Lincoln faithful is needed more than ever. A week after a penalty miss that sent some supporters into a rather seismic and ridiculous meltdown, we need to galvanise and as one, get behind this team on a charge to promotion. Sing and shout your hearts out in support no matter what.
